Transaction 1ad5be2d916fb63f66fa3ae76fb33a8e40bacde07cf69e29c579af19d5865594

26 Input
2 Outputs
  • 1ad5be2d916fb63f66fa3ae76fb33a8e40bacde07cf69e29c579af19d5865594:0
  • value  2183770955
    address  3JdR3X3kyqtxpQDFp7i3amTKqdCDbZtvMS
  • 1ad5be2d916fb63f66fa3ae76fb33a8e40bacde07cf69e29c579af19d5865594:1
  • value  23666375
    address  33BrbVyswy28RoxTA3xEvUyC4tnsB9PG8o